How payouts work
Online and in-store card payments typically take 2 business days to be paid into your bank account.
Payments are bundled into payouts - e.g. if two customers have paid today:
- Payment #1: - £10
- Payment #2: - £20
In 2 business days, you will receive a payout of £30 (minus fees).
Here are some general examples of the timing:
| Customer payment | Payout to you | 
| TUE 1st:  | THU 3rd:  | 
| WED 2nd:  | FRI 4th:  | 
| THU 3rd:  | MON 7th:  | 
| FRI 4th:  | TUE 8th:  | 
| SAT 5th:  SUN 6th:  MON 7th:  | WED 9th:  | 
By default, the payout schedule is daily (excluding weekends and bank holidays), but we can configure it to be weekly or monthly on a nominated day at your request.
Within Settings > Online Payments > [Transfers], your current balance shows the pending amount for future payouts. This figure will update with new payments/refunds. Payouts that have been created (if any) will be listed below it in order of recency:
You can tap Details against a payout to view its breakdown of payments/refunds.
Checking payments and payouts
On an appointment/payment record where an online or in-store card payment has been recorded, you can tap it in the Payment box to view information about it:
The [View Payout] button takes you to the payout it was included in.
You can view all your payouts within Settings > Online Payments > [Transfers].
About refunds
If an online refund is issued, the amount is immediately deducted from your current balance (affecting the next payout), and reaches the customer's bank account within 5-10 business days.
As an example, if you have two payments in your balance that are due for a payout tomorrow:
- Payment #1: - £10
- Payment #2: - £10
- Current balance: - £20
If a £5 refund is issued today, your balance would become £15, payable to you in tomorrow's payout. The payout breakdown would include:
- Payment #1: - £10
- Payment #2: - £10
- Refund: - -£5
- Payout: - £15 (minus fees)
Why has a payout not arrived?
- Payouts are only made on working days (e.g. Monday - Friday), so if a weekly or monthly payout is scheduled for a Saturday or a Sunday it will be made on the following working day. 
 
- Payouts may be delayed over bank holidays until the following business day. 
 
- If a payout does not arrive on schedule, please wait an extra day in case your bank experiences a slight delay in receiving it. 
 
- You will not receive a payout if your balance is negative (due to refunds), or below the minimum payout amount (e.g. £1 / €1 / $1 - this may vary by country). A payout will be scheduled once you exceed this minimum.
